What Kind of Egg Roll Wrappers Should I Use?

Look for egg roll wrappers in the refrigerated section of most grocery stores, usually near the tofu or fresh herbs. You’ll want wrappers labeled specifically for “egg rolls” and not “spring rolls,” as those are thinner and better suited for delicate fillings. Egg roll wrappers hold up beautifully in the air fryer and deliver that signature crackly bite you’re after.

How To Make the Crispy Air Fryer Chicken Egg Rolls

Step 1: Mix the Filling

In a large bowl, combine the shredded chicken, cabbage or coleslaw mix, carrots, minced garlic, soy sauce, sesame oil, ginger, and chopped green onions. Stir until everything is evenly coated and well mixed.

Step 2: Assemble the Egg Rolls

Place a wrapper on a flat surface in a diamond shape. Spoon a few tablespoons of the filling near the bottom corner. Fold the corner over the filling, then fold in the sides, and roll tightly. Seal the final edge with a dab of water.

Step 3: Preheat and Spray

Preheat your air fryer to 375°F. Lightly spray the basket with olive oil. Also spray each egg roll with a bit of oil to ensure golden crispness.

Step 4: Cook Until Crispy

Place egg rolls in the basket, seam side down, without overcrowding. Air fry for 10-12 minutes, flipping halfway through, until golden brown and crispy.

How to Serve and Store Crispy Chicken Egg Rolls

These egg rolls are perfect hot out of the air fryer, served with dipping sauces like sweet chili, soy sauce, or sriracha mayo. They’re also a fun appetizer for parties or potlucks. This recipe makes about 12 egg rolls, enough to feed 4 to 6 people as a snack or appetizer.

To store leftovers, let the egg rolls cool completely, then refrigerate in an airtight container for up to 3 days. Reheat in the air fryer at 350°F for 3-5 minutes to bring back that crispy texture. You can also freeze them before cooking for up to 2 months.

Crispy Air Fryer Chicken Egg Rolls

  • Author: Janet Reynolds
  • Total Time: 27 minutes
  • Yield: 12 egg rolls

Ingredients

12 egg roll wrappers

2 cups cooked shredded chicken

1 1/2 cups shredded cabbage or coleslaw mix

1/2 cup shredded carrots

2 cloves garlic, minced

2 tablespoons soy sauce

1 teaspoon sesame oil

1/2 teaspoon ground ginger

2 green onions, chopped

Olive oil spray


Instructions

1. In a large bowl, mix shredded chicken, cabbage, carrots, garlic, soy sauce, sesame oil, ginger, and green onions until evenly combined.

2. Place a wrapper on a flat surface with a corner pointing toward you. Spoon 2-3 tablespoons of filling near the bottom.

3. Fold the bottom corner over filling, then fold in sides and roll tightly. Dab a little water on the final corner to seal.

4. Preheat air fryer to 375°F. Spray the basket with olive oil.

5. Spray each egg roll lightly with oil and place seam-side down in the basket.

6. Air fry in batches for 10-12 minutes, flipping halfway, until golden and crisp.

7. Serve hot with dipping sauces like sweet chili or spicy mayo.

Notes

Use rotisserie chicken for quick prep.

Don’t overcrowd the air fryer to ensure even crisping.

Seal egg rolls well to prevent splitting during cooking.
